Output 814872462ab4d7b9e36138e0a51702ee716fddc7d01ff476efcb1764b8e2164f:7

value
2659044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34bd0da8bc968dca8e80c12ce7cc84380efe718b OP_EQUAL
address
36VsYBBdozJBryH7F2AHKz2c29psFhSBf6
transaction
814872462ab4d7b9e36138e0a51702ee716fddc7d01ff476efcb1764b8e2164f
spent
true